Punjab Vidhan Sabha Speaker S Kultar Singh Sandhwan today awarded Bharat Vibhusan Samman 2026 in Punjab Vidhan Sabha to eminent and distinguished personalities related to different fields. Institute for Social Reforms and Higher Education Charitable Trust (ISRHE) has selected these renowned personalities for Bharat Vibhusan Samman 2026.

In this function, Punjab Legislative Assembly Speaker S Kultar Singh Sandhwan was the chief guest. During the award ceremony, MLA Brahm Shankar Jimpa, MLA Inderjit Kaur Mann, MLA Inderbir Singh Nijjar, MLA Kulwant Singh Pandori and Swami Brahm Muni Ji, Visionary Spiritual Guru were present to grace the occasion.

Speaker Sandhwan also presented Lohi and memento to Spiritual Guru Brahm Muni Ji. Besides this, ISRHE presented a Lohi and Memento to Speaker Punjab Vidhan Sabha and Secretary Punjab Vidhan Sabha.
